摘要
现代科学技术飞速发展,数据库技术是计算机科学技术发展最快,应用最为广泛的技术之一。其在计算机设计,人工智能,电子商务,企业管理,科学计算等诸多领域均得到了广泛的应用,已经成为计算机信息系统和应用的核心技术和重要基础。
如今随着信息技术的飞速发展,信息化的大环境给社会更层次人员提供了国际互联,实现静态资源共享,动态信息发布的要求; 信息化对学生个人提出了驾驭和掌握最新信息技术的素质要求;信息技术提供了对教学进行重大革新的新手段;信息化也为提高教学质量,提高管理水平,工作效率创造了有效途径.
本文主要介绍人事管理系统的数据库方面的设计,从需求分析到数据库的运行与维护都进行详细的叙述。本系统利用IBM DB2 企业版本开发出来的。DB2 是IBM 公司开发的关系关系数据库管理系统,它把SQL 语言作为查询语言。
本企业人事管理系统采用C/S结构,在Windows XP操作系统下,主要对企业员工的信息以及跟人事相关的工作流程进行集中的管理,方便企业建立一个完善的、强大的员工信息数据库。
本文的分为  5 章。其中第  1 章主要是课题简介及设计的内容与目的。第  2 章是需求分析,此阶段是数据库设计的起点。第  3 章是概念设计,它是将需求分析的用户需求抽象为信息结构,这是整个数据库设计最
困难的阶段。第  4 章是逻辑结构设计,它将概念模型转换为某个DBMS 所支持的数据模型。第  5 章是数据库的实施与运行,它包括数据的载入及数据库的运行。
关键词:人事管理系统;SQL ;数据库技术
第一章前言
1.1课题简介
随着现代科技的高速发展,设备和管理越来越现代化,在实际工作中如何提高管理人事的工作效率成为一个很重要的问题。而建立管理信息系统是一个很好的解决办法。通过近来的学习,我对计算机技术有了基础的了解,而数据库技术它是以Microsoft Visual Studio 2005和SQL 2005数据库作为开发平台,使用C# 设计操作控件和编写操作程序,完成数据输入、修改、存储、调用查询等功能;并使用SQL 2005数据库形成数据表,进行数据存储。本文详细介绍了企业人事管理系统的功能需求,系统设计和具体实现。并简要介绍了系统开发采用的过程方法。
1.2设计目的
当今社会随着各大公司规模的扩大,经济体制的快速发展,公司组织管理会变得越来越庞大和困难,而信息的处理与使用也变得越来越重要。它的内容对企业的决策者和管理者来说都至关重要,所以,人事
管理系统应能够为用户提供充足的信息和快捷的查询手段。建立一套人事管理系统能够加快物资的周转速度,提高生产效率,加强管理的信息化手段,提高本单位的经济效益。从宏观上讲,顺应了社会的信息化、社会化潮流,缩短了整个社会化大生产的周期。因此,开发这样一套管理软件成为很有必要的事情。
人事管理的对象是一个单位或若干单位种的员工的基本信息,这些信息是在变化的。人事部门要为本单位、上级部门提供准确的统计数据。由于人员众多、数据复杂、统计管理工作困难,以往每做一项工作,都需要花费很多的时间和精力。传统的人工管理方式有诸如效率低,保密性差,查、更新、维护困难等各种各样的缺点。因此,人事管理系统能够味用户提供充足的信息和快捷的查询手段。
与此同时数据库应用课程实践:实践和巩固在课堂教学中学习的关于DB2 的有关知识,熟练掌握对于给定结构的数据库的创建、基本操作、程序系统的建立和调试以及系统评价。
本次课程设计的主要内容是构建一个公司人事管理系统,采用的主要技术是基于服务器端SQL。本文按照数据库系统设计的基本步骤,采取了事先进行需求
分析,然后进行数据库的概念设计和逻辑结构设计,最后进行数据库详细设计的方法,完成了一个人事管理系统数据库系统的设计。最终,在SQL SEVER 2000完成的人事管理系统,可以实现:对员工基本档案的管理、奖惩记录的管理、出勤记录的管理、职务调动记录的管理、工资管理、请销假管理。人事
档案管理信息系统,作为数据库管理系统的一个具体应用,在实际工作中得到了广泛的应用,因为通过它能对企事业单位的人力资源进行卓有成效的管理,提高了管理的效率,方便了使用,通过一系列的操作可以快速、可靠的进行人事档案的更新、查,极大的提高了工作效率,是现代企事业单位必不可少的办公软件。本分析报告是为项目开发者、投资者、领导,以及参与实施本项目的工作者作参考,为了方便公司的人事管理。
第二章需求分析
2.1业务需求及处理流程
人事管理系统业务需求分析的任务是调查人事应用领域,对应用领域中的信息要求和操作要求进行详细分析,形成需求分析说明书。重点是调查,收集与分析人事管理中的信息要求,处理要求,数据的安全性与完整性要求。
本文就公司人事管理系统的设计与实现进行了认真的分析研究,结合工作环境和管理需求,建立了一个高效、稳定的人事管理系统,达到了先进、安全、实用、可靠的目标,并对今后新的需求有很好的扩展性。随着市场竞争的愈演愈烈,越来越多的企业管理者认识到人力资源是企业的“第一资源”,人力资源管理正与市场营销、财务管理、生产管理构成现代企业管理的四大支柱。企业在上人事管理系统前,人事管理系统提供商应帮助企业完成人事管理系统需求分析的工作。建设人力资源管理系统项目的重点正
是引进先进的人力资源管理理念与手段,在各类人员中、在各业务板块中、在公司管控层面实现集中式的管理第一阶段:系统设定培训系统设计从正式的程序培训开始,通过系统的培训指导,可以帮助用户快速掌握数据模拟练习的操作方法。第二阶段:详细系统需求分析人事管理系统提供商会对现有业务和IT现状进行调查和初步诊断,明确系统初步实施的目标与范围,与项目团队共同分析人事系统需求,从而根据现状制定具体的行动方案。第三阶段:系统设计(如:编码原则)在这个阶段中,会进一步明确公司政策,人事管理系统会确定相关的类似组织结构、员工编号等编码规则。第四阶段:公司政策大纲基于前期的讨论,人事管理系统提供商会着手进行相关系统的搭建,从而形成最终的需求分析文件,如:公司政策大纲、项目启动计划等。
2.2 功能需求分析
登录管理:该模块实现重新登录、用户设置、系统退出等功能,使用户能正确的登录和使用该系统。
人员管理:1.新增:添加新员工的个人信息。2.修改:修改已有员工的个人信息。3.删除:删除已有员工的个人信息。4.查询:根据条件查询员工的信息。
5.撤销:消除员工个人信息。6:浏览:浏览查看所有员工个人信息。
部门管理:对公司所有的部门进行编号,建立部门记录。部门管理包括添加,修改,删除。
报表打印
2.3业务规则分析
业务规则分析主要是分析数据之间的约束及数据库约束。基于上述人数管理系统的功能需求,通过进一步了解,人数管理系统的业务规则如下:(1)员工通过人事系统进行登录操作。
(2)每一个员工的工号都是唯一的。
(3)每一个员工归属于一个部门。每一个部门下有多个员工。db2数据库sql语句
(4)通过简单、直接的用户界面使用户进行方便快捷的操作。
(5)通过完善,规范的后台数据库,使系统的数据处理、存储功能更加安全、可靠和稳定。
(6)可逐步提高企事业单位的管理水平,提高工作效率,以达到良好的效果。
(7)通系统维护方便可靠,有较高的安全性,满足实用性、先进性的要求。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。